When St. Lawrence College students have a hard time finding that key piece of information, they go to the library. More often than not they’ll speak with Jill Baker, the college librarian.
But as of January 12th, all of that will change.
The position of Librarian will be replaced by an Associate Director of Libraries and Student Success. [Our emphasis] The person in this role will oversee various departments, with only 20 per cent dedicated to the college’s libraries.
In a statement to CKWS TV, the school says this is all part of a new ‘student success model’.
